Benjamin Baillaud
Édouard Benjamin Baillaud (14 February 1848 – 8 July 1934) (aged 86) was a French astronomer.

Edward D. DiPrete
Edward Daniel DiPrete (born July 8, 1934) is an American Republican Party politician from Rhode Island.

Marty Feldman
Martin Alan "Marty" Feldman (8 July 1934 – 2 December 1982) was a British comedy writer, comedian, and actor, known for his prominent, misaligned eyes.
